Humayun Bio

Humayun, born Nasir-ud-Din Muhammad, was the second emperor of the Mughal Empire in India, ruling from 1530 to 1540 and again from 1555 to 1556. He was the eldest son of Babur, the founder of the Mughal dynasty, and ascended to the throne after his father's death in 1530. Humayun is remembered for his struggles to maintain and expand the Mughal Empire during a tumultuous period in Indian history. During his first reign, Humayun faced numerous challenges, including rebellions by his own brothers and Afghan nobles, as well as invasions by the rulers of Gujarat and Bengal. These conflicts weakened his hold on power, leading to his defeat and exile in 1540. However, Humayun did not give up his quest to reclaim the throne and made a dramatic comeback in 1555 with the help of Persian allies. Humayun's second reign was marked by efforts to consolidate and expand the Mughal Empire, including successful military campaigns in Gujarat, Malwa, and Bengal. He also laid the foundation for the magnificent Mughal architecture that his son Akbar would later perfect. Humayun's reign was cut short by his untimely death in 1556, but his legacy as a visionary leader and architect of the Mughal Empire would endure through his descendants.
